    A Senate report identifies close to 1.8K occurrences of fake electronics parts within the defense industry supply chain. The investigation found roughly 70% of the counterfeit parts could be traced back to China with the U.K. and Canada also in the mix. Execs from RTN, LLL, and BA are at a Capitol Hill hearing to try and explain the "potential impact" of the problem on defense systems.
